WebIf they can collect the entire amount from you alone then they likely will. If you file a joint return with your spouse and generate $50,000 in taxes owed, both spouses are individually responsible for this $50,000 until it is paid. Again, one spouse could potentially foot the entire bill if the IRS decides to pursue that spouse. WebAug 21, 2024 · In case your divorce is not yet finalized, you could file joint return if you remain married at the end of a tax year or as of December 31. Both husband and wife must provide consent to this filing. If there is no consent and you are still married, then your options are to file “married filing separately” or “head of household.”. Webdivorce settlement. Take the divorce of one of the most famous corporate executives of all time, Jack Welch, former chairman of GE. His highly publicized divorce included a tax indemnity agreement with his ex-wife, Jane Beasley. Kranhold, “Welch Sets Tax Indemnity for Ex-Wife,” The Wall Street Journal, July 7, 2003, at C7. Sometimes a lessee may indemnify the lessor, on an after-tax basis, for certain tax benefits the lessor may lose if a change in the tax law precludes realization of those tax benefits. Accounting for indemnification payments is addressed in ASC 840-10-25 under Guarantees and Indemnifications.
